Arizona has permitless (constitutional) concealed carry: anyone 21 or older who may lawfully possess a firearm may carry concealed without a permit (A.R.S. § 13-3102). Residency is not required. Members of the U.S. armed forces and honorably discharged veterans may carry concealed at 19+.

The Arizona Concealed Weapons Permit (CWP) still matters
The CWP remains available in Arizona even though a permit is not required to carry concealed within the state. It is worth obtaining anyway: most states that grant reciprocity honor a valid out-of-state permit, not another state's permitless-carry law. Holding the CWP is typically what lets a Arizona resident carry concealed while traveling to a state that recognizes it.

Arizona constitutional carry FAQ
- Can I carry concealed in Arizona without a permit?
- Yes. Arizona is a constitutional (permitless) carry state — an eligible adult at least 21 years old who may lawfully possess a firearm can carry a concealed handgun in Arizona without first obtaining the CWP.
- Should I still get a Arizona CWP if I can carry permitless?
- Yes. The CWP remains available in Arizona and is worth holding because permitless carry is only valid inside Arizona's own borders — most other states extend reciprocity to a valid permit, not to Arizona's permitless-carry law. A Arizona CWP lets you carry concealed while traveling to states that honor it.
- Does permitless carry in Arizona work in other states?
- No. Permitless carry is a Arizona-specific legal status and does not travel with you. Reciprocity agreements are between states' permit systems — carrying in another state generally requires either that state's own permitless-carry law (if it has one) or a permit that state's reciprocity list recognizes.
